Output e84e90fa1c36581b02f3d244941b1ef994fe483f448a7353f2e863197036519a:138

value
2489283
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b0b2343d98dab3cee96087084517efd1d98b314 OP_EQUAL
address
3BT1Zw9L85dtNs3XC97AXvmMPsQjpJ8fUc
transaction
e84e90fa1c36581b02f3d244941b1ef994fe483f448a7353f2e863197036519a
confirmations
199289
spent
true